The story is a fictionalized account of the lives of the Mirabal sisters, Dominican revolutionary activists, who opposed the dictatorship of Rafael Trujillo and were assassinated on November 25, 1960. In the film, Salma Hayek played one of the sisters, Minerva, and Edward James Olmos plays Trujillo.

  4. In the Time of the Butterflies. Based on a novel by Julia Alvarez and inspired by the true story of the three Mirabal sisters who were murdered, in 1960, for their part in an underground plot to overthrow the dictatorship of General Trujillo in the Dominican Republic.
